rcu: Force per-rcu_node kthreads off of the outgoing CPU

The scheduler has had some heartburn in the past when too many real-time
kthreads were affinitied to the outgoing CPU.  So, this commit lightens
the load by forcing the per-rcu_node and the boost kthreads off of the
outgoing CPU.  Note that RCU's per-CPU kthread remains on the outgoing
CPU until the bitter end, as it must in order to preserve correctness.

Also avoid disabling hardirqs across calls to set_cpus_allowed_ptr(),
given that this function can block.
